WebAdditional regulations apply to licensed New Hampshire Hunting Guides. Contact the Law Enforcement Division at (603) 271-3127. Lacey Act. Interstate transportation of wildlife taken, possessed, transported, or sold in violation of a state law is a violation of federal law. The penalty can be up to $250,000 and 5 years in prison. WebIf you discover a bear in your living space, give it a clear escape route and do not corner it. Do not lock the bear in a room. A person who suffers loss or damage to livestock, bees, orchards or growing crops, by bear or mountain lion, may … slugterra shooting gamesWebResident Landowner special licenses must be purchased from Fish and Game headquarters, either in person or by mail. Children under 16 years of age do not need a regular N.H. hunting or archery license. Youth must be accompanied by a properly licensed person 18 years of age or older.
